Grounded Fact-Check
A citation proves a number was written down somewhere; it does not prove the number is right. This skill is a pre-publication check on the handful of specifics a decision rests on: each is re-verified against live sources with a query that does not reveal the drafted value, and the draft is reconciled to what the sources say. It adapts the newsroom discipline described by Lucas Graves (Deciding What's True, 2016) and codified in the IFCN Code of Principles (2016), whose sourcing commitment requires evidence a reader can follow and replicate — applied here to a draft's own assertions rather than to a politician's. The failure it prevents is the fabricated-but-plausible specific — a wrong figure presented behind a citation and a confident tone, so every later reviewer assumes someone already checked it.

Procedure
1 — Extract the load-bearing claims
List the specific, present-or-past-tense, externally checkable claims a reader would act on — the top 5–12 by decision weight. Record each as drafted, with its exact value and whether it already carries a citation. Leave out forecasts, hedged framing and claims already marked as estimates: the budget of lookups belongs to the specifics that would change a decision if wrong.
2 — Verify each with a neutral query
For every claim, look it up with a question that does not state the drafted value — anchoring the search on the draft is how a wrong number gets confirmed. Draft "Majorana 1 has 32 logical qubits" becomes the query "how many qubits does Microsoft's Majorana 1 chip have, and are they physical or logical?". Read the sources returned, prefer the most original one (the vendor's own announcement, the filing, the standard), and record its locator.
3 — Classify each claim against what the sources state
| Sources vs. draft | Verdict | Action |
|---|
| Sources state the same specific value | confirmed | Keep; ensure the citation points at a source that actually states it |
| Sources state a different, specific value | corrected | Replace the draft value with the sourced one and cite that source |
| No source states a specific value, or they conflict | unverifiable | Do not assert it: hedge ("reportedly", "as of {year}"), tag as an estimate, or drop it |
Bias toward unverifiable over corrected when the result is fuzzy: only correct when a source states a clearly different specific value. Inventing a "corrected" number from a vague result is a new fabrication.
4 — Reconcile and emit the ledger
Apply every correction before publication. The published text must contain zero claims still contradicted by the sources, and every claim kept as unverifiable must be visibly hedged — never left behind a citation as though confirmed. Then emit the ledger below alongside (not inside) the document, so the corrections are auditable by whoever reviews it.

Worked example
Illustrative draft, a quantum-hardware brief with three load-bearing specifics. Step 1 extracts them; step 2 queries each neutrally; step 3 classifies:
| # | Claim as drafted | Neutral query | What sources state | Verdict |
|---|
| 1 | "Microsoft's Majorana 1 carries 32 logical qubits [3]" | "How many qubits does Microsoft's Majorana 1 chip have, physical or logical?" | Microsoft announcement, 19 February 2025: "eight topological qubits on a chip designed to scale to one million" | corrected → 8 topological qubits |
| 2 | "Quantinuum's H2 system reaches 56 qubits" | "How many qubits does Quantinuum's System Model H2 have?" | Quantinuum product page: "56 fully-connected qubits" | confirmed |
| 3 | "China overtook the US in quantum computing in 2023" | "When did China surpass the US in quantum computing, by what measure?" | No source states a specific overtaking date or measure; commentary conflicts | unverifiable → hedged |
Claim 1 is the case this skill exists for: it carried citation [3] and a confident tone, and was wrong by both magnitude and kind (logical vs topological). Claim 3 is rewritten as "China leads the US on some published quantum metrics as of 2025 [estimate]". Ledger:

Anti-patterns
- Do not treat a citation, a source grade or a confident tone as verification. Those are the camouflage this check removes.
- Do not phrase the query so it echoes the draft ("is it true that Majorana 1 has 32 logical qubits?") — it biases the search toward confirmation.
- Do not spend lookups on forecasts or opinions. Scope to checkable specifics.
- Do not invent a corrected value when the result is fuzzy. Hedge or drop instead.
- Do not skip a claim because it looks obviously right. Obvious-looking numbers are the ones that ship wrong.
Reference
- L. Graves, Deciding What's True: The Rise of Political Fact-Checking in American Journalism. New York: Columbia University Press, 2016. ISBN 978-0-231-17507-4 — the ethnography of newsroom fact-checking practice this procedure adapts.
- International Fact-Checking Network, IFCN Code of Principles, Poynter Institute, launched September 2016 — commitments to standards and transparency of sources and to open corrections. https://ifcncodeofprinciples.poynter.org/
- S. Dhuliawala et al., "Chain-of-Verification Reduces Hallucination in Large Language Models," in Findings of the Association for Computational Linguistics: ACL 2024, pp. 3563–3578, 2024. doi:10.18653/v1/2024.findings-acl.212 — the independence principle behind the neutral query.
